This weekend is the annual Maker Faire, a celebration of the DIY enthusiast (read: mad scientists of the world). It’s an incredible, family friendly event with a whole host of things to do, see, and MAKE. The Faire is at the San Mateo Country Fairgrounds, more info available on their website: http://makerfaire.com/
This year, there will be science discussions happening at the Maker Faire. From 12-4 PM on Saturday & Sunday. I’ll be there on Sunday helping facilitate the cafe discussion. So come on down and join the fun!
The lineup includes (but not limited to):
- ZEKE KOSSOVER: physics circus
- PAULA SHADLE: biology/animals
- CHRIS McCARTHY: astronomer
- SUSAN McCARTHY: author/animals
- KEITH DEVLIN: math
